So you have your games in C:\DOSgames and you type:
mount c c:\dosgames
C:

What do you see on the screen next? It should be:
C:\>

You said the full path is C:\DOSgames\oregon_trail_dos. Since you mounted C:\DOSgames the folder names after that should be no longer than 8 characters for ease of use. If you use the dir command oregon_trail_dos would appear truncated to oregon~1.

First of all you need to be aware that dos games don't behave as console games. You need to install them and run their executable. So they are not working in dosbox as console games work in a console emulator (no instant loading).
Second find best find your real CD Roms again and start over by following the 60 seconds guide 60 seconds guide to getting your game to run in DOSBox
Start over means, get rid of the game or installation files, at least don't use them when you follow the guide.
